## Rollout Runbook: Flagpole Framework

Flagpole controls staged feature rollouts for the Corveth platform. Flags move through four stages: internal, canary, ramp, full. Never skip canary. Ramp increments are capped at 10% per hour; the scheduler enforces this, don't override it. If error rates spike during ramp, hit the kill switch in the Flagpole console — it reverts within sixty seconds. Rollback does not clear flag state; file a cleanup task afterward. The evaluator boots with the configuration shown below.

service settings:
[casax]
port = 6379
team = rusir
host = casax.zemvarhq.corp
region = outer-4
access_code = ac_9808ce
timeout_ms = 1500

Alert: Glazeline tile cache eviction spike. Fires when the rendering cache evicts more than 30% of entries within five minutes. Plugins issuing uncached tile variants are the usual cause. Expect slower tile delivery until the cache warms. Guidance on cache-friendly variant keys for plugin authors is published on the page below.

operations page: https://jenkins.zemvarcloud.local/job/merge_requests/repo/build/73930b4b30f0a8ed

## Formula sandbox tuning

User-supplied formulas in Gridmoor execute inside a restricted interpreter with hard ceilings on time, memory, and call depth. Reviewers should confirm any change to these ceilings is justified in the PR description, since raising them widens the abuse surface. Defaults were chosen from production traces. The current limits are as follows.

limits module of tafog-fawip:
WEIGHTS = {
    "julix": 57,
    "lamys": 992,
    "kasvan": 209,
    "quenok": 750,
    "alddor": 259,
    "oliath": 1009,
    "wenix": 815,
}